* In 1998, a security barrier popped up out of a driveway at [[The Pentagon]] while a limousine carrying Japan's defense minister was driving over it. The minister was slightly injured; the limo was in rather worse shape. In 2000, Germany's defense minister was likewise slightly injured by an essentially identical accident; it may even have been the very same barrier.
